**Runbook: FD leak hunt — Tidemarsh ingest nodes**

We're still chasing the descriptor leak on the ingest tier; counts climb roughly 200 FDs/hour under load until the kernel limit trips. Current approach: enable the probe agent, let it sample lsof snapshots every five minutes, and correlate with connection churn in the broker. Set `FD_PROBE_INTERVAL=300` and `FD_PROBE_TARGET=ingest` in the agent env file. The probe uploads snapshots to the diagnostics vault, which requires its upload secret on the line directly after the target setting.

vault entry, yahif-yajep: COURIER_KEY29=b802bdf8034096b65a51c6ba5abe2

**Key Ceremony Checklist — Item 7 (Pinewharf Imaging)**

Before signing the release that patches the Pinewharf image-cache memory leak, confirm the heap snapshot from the soak test is attached to the ceremony record. New contractors: the signing workstation stays offline throughout. Unlocking the signing key requires the ceremony recovery passphrase, read aloud by the custodian. The current passphrase is noted below.

vault phrase of taweg-kafof = oliax-zorael

Subject: Cut-over summary — Vellum template engine

Hi team, the cut-over to Vellum's precompiled template cache completed Saturday without rollback. Render p95 dropped from 210ms to 38ms on the Quillhaven cluster. No privilege changes were made; cache files are read-only at runtime. For your audit, the full runtime configuration as deployed is listed below.

service settings:
[pelius]
port = 5432
team = praius
host = pelius.crelvoforge.internal
region = upper-4
access_code = ac_8f224d
timeout_ms = 2000

Subject: On-call handover — Fernwick API pagination

Handing over the pager. Overnight we saw plugin authors hitting the deprecated offset pagination on /v2/listings; it's slated for removal next release. Cursor-based pagination is stable and documented in the portal. One partner reported duplicate pages — traced to mixing cursors across sorts, not a server bug. If partners ask about migration timelines, point them to the address below.

escalation mailbox, hadug-bajog: sormir@norvalabs.internal